Our Story & Mission

We started helping hungry families in Southeast Ohio over 40 years ago. Our mission is "Helping our neighbors with food and support." True today, and true from our founding.

Frank Hare, with other local pastors from Athens OH, started the Athens County Food panty in 1980. His dedication and leadership helped the pantry grow from a collection of churches united to serve families to a vital organization that continues to advance its mission of fighting food insecurity in the region.

Thank you to our donors

We thank all of our generous donors. Without their donations, both large and small, we could not do the work we do. We are thankful for our individual donors, including all our friends in Louisiana, Cincinnati, and beyond. We especially thank Joe Burrow for shining a light on hunger in SE Ohio, leading to the creation of our endowment, the Joe Burrow Hunger Relief Fund. (And for Will Drabold and others for starting Facebook fundraisers.)

We depend entirely upon the support of our local and extended community, through individual and group donations, churches, business partners, fundraisers, and grants.
